1991—No. 41

CHIROPRACTIC ACT 1978—REGULATION

(Relating to fees)

NEW SOUTH WALES

[Published in Gazette No. 20 of 1 February 1991]

HIS Excellency the Governor, with the advice of the Executive Council, and in pursuance of the Chiropractic Act 1978, has been pleased to make the Regulation set forth hereunder.

PETER COLLINS

Minister for Health.

Commencement

1. This Regulation commences on 28 February 1991.

Amendments

2. The Chiropractic Regulation 1979 is amended:

(a)

by omitting from clause 7 (1) the matter “$126” and by inserting instead the matter “$140”;

(b)

by omitting from clause 7 (2) the matter “$64” and by inserting instead the matter “$90”.

EXPLANATORY NOTE

The object of this Regulation is to amend the Chiropractic Regulation 1979 to increase certain fees payable in connection with the registration of chiropractors
and osteopaths.
